Here is a fun, vintage (circa 1936) hard cover (no dust jacket) cookbook titled... Food for Family Company and Crowd Cookbook by Jessie Marie DeBoth Director of Homemaker's Schools of Chicago, New York and Canada and with a chapter by Dr. Herman N. Bundesen, this cookbook starts with nutrition & information food groups.

Chapters include: Eating to live a long, healthy life, How to use this book, Dinners with Baked or Roasted Meats, Dinners with Broiled or Fried Meats, Dinners with Braised or Stewed Meats, Pot Luck Dinners, Appetizers, Soups, Potatoes - Rice - Pasta, Vegetables, Salads & Dressings, Frozen Desserts, Cakes - Fillings - Frostings, Pastry. Buffet and Bridge Parties, Buffet and Party Sandwiches, The Soda Fountain Bar , Home Canned Sweets and Pickles. There is a TON of recipes in this recipe book! 384 pages with index.
